The obvious heuristic for Rubik's Cube is a three dimensional version of the Manhattan distance. For each cubie, compute the minimum number of moves required to correctly position and orient it, and sum these values over all cubies.Unfortunately, to be admissible, this value has to be divided by 8, since every twist …

For this guide, we will use the M2 method on the edges and the Old Pochmann method on the corners. deakin university e333WebbOLL or Orientation of the Last Layer is the third step of the CFOP method, which aims to orient (same color facing up) the top layer of the 3x3. This step is fully algorithmic, and consists of 57 cases. Two look OLL is a smaller subset which orients the top layer in two stages.
